Output cfb7e9763216b07625a47556d6674a0b52e532c4550066de4f3c8d58d830314e:14

value
134580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e70ad98577b671753872dd22809314b90c815fa8 OP_EQUAL
address
3Nkf1hvm3uBhpCsuvEWhW3wuqjVXfr3QEx
transaction
cfb7e9763216b07625a47556d6674a0b52e532c4550066de4f3c8d58d830314e
spent
true